**Mgmt Meeting Minutes — Retiring the Brightline Range**

Quick recap for sales leads at Fenholt Supplies: we agreed to retire the Brightline fixture range by year-end. Remaining stock moves to clearance pricing next month, and accounts on standing orders get migrated to the Lumetta range. Trade-in incentives were approved in principle. The confidential note on next steps sits just below.

board note of bajof-bajeg: The pricing group signed off on a budget of $13.4 million for Project Sildor. The renewal with Lamixek Holdings closes at $48.9 million a year, 49 percent above the last contract.

Quarterly Planning Note — Customer Concentration

Branch managers: Halloway Systems now represents 38% of consolidated revenue, up from 29% last year. That concentration is unacceptable. Each branch must submit a diversification target by month-end, with at least two new mid-tier prospects in active pipeline. No exceptions. Central will track progress weekly. Context for these targets is set out in the confidential item immediately below.

board note of kagep-yahig: Only 9 of the 120 pilot accounts renewed Quenix, so a churn review is set for April 1.

Onboarding note for the Ledgerpane admin table: bulk edits are applied through the batcher service, not directly against the database. Select rows, choose an action, and the batcher stages changes in a pending set you can review before commit. Edits over 500 rows require a second approver — this is enforced server-side, so don't try to chunk around it. To run the batcher locally you need the staging write credential, which goes in your .env as the next line.

secret setting of bahip-kagag: RELAY_SECRET3=c83

## Deploying the Gatewick Proctor Queue

Deploys are pretty painless: push to main, wait for the pipeline, then watch the queue drain dashboard for five minutes. If candidates pile up mid-exam, roll back first and ask questions later — the queue replays safely. Everything the workers care about lives in one config block, shown here for reference.

settings of bafof-yagef:
JOROX_PIN=8740
JOROX_TENANT=pelox
JOROX_METRICS_HOST=metrics.jorox.qorvelworks.internal
JOROX_SEAL=seal_c78f63c1
JOROX_STANDBY_TEAM=norax